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services
Federal agency administering Medicare, Medicaid, and ACA marketplace plans. Sets reimbursement rates, drug pricing rules, and prior authorization policies that directly affect insurer and pharma profits.

Regulatory Capture Assessment
Regulatory capture occurs when a regulatory agency advances the interests of the industry it is meant to oversee. The indicators below track evidence of capture for this agency. According to the academic literature (Stigler 1971, Carpenter & Moss 2013), captured agencies exhibit declining enforcement, revolving door personnel pipelines, and rule-making that favors incumbents over public interest.
